On tap at Aztec Brewing Company in Vista, CA.

Pours a slightly murky dark brown with a beige head that settles to a film on top of the beer. Small dots of lace drip into the remaining beer on the drink down. Smell is of malt, brown sugar, dark fruits, and some slight bourbon aromas. Taste is very much the same even down to subtle bourbon flavors. This beer has a good level of carbonation with a crisp mouthfeel. Overall, this is a good dubbel with an interesting method of fermenting the beer in Heaven Hill barrels.
